What Travellers Say
Reviews Summary
Guests consistently praise the exceptional hospitality of hosts Ellen and Billy, highlighting the warm welcome and personalized touches that make their stays feel like home. The delicious food, often made with ingredients from the kitchen garden, and the comfortable, well-appointed rooms are frequently mentioned positives. While most experiences are overwhelmingly positive, some reviews focus on the accommodation aspect rather than just the restaurant.

Dog Friendly Hotels around Exmoor
In one of the most beautiful parts of the British Isles, Cross Lane House is a Grade-II listed building which provides 4-star hotel accommodation to discerning travellers. Paws Policy: Cross Lane House welcomes small to medium-sized dogs who are able to stay in the ‘Pluck’ or ‘Fry’ rooms for the additional charge of £10 per stay. Four-legged guests can go into the bar and lounge, but not the restaurant.
